    Why is kolkata missing out on hosting the final?

    Kolkata’s eden gardens has long been a premier venue for ipl playoffs, but this year, unforeseen weather patterns and logistical challenges have LED the BCCI to reconsiders. The early onset of the southwest monsoon, which is expected to brings rains and thundersstorms to kolkata by the first week of June, have raised serial concerns. Accuweather forecasts a 65% chance of precitation on June 3, the day of the final, making it a risky proposation to host a marquee event.

    According to the India Meteorological Department (IMD), The Monsoon’s Advance Into The Southern Bay of Bengal is expected to affect to affect kolkata and the entrere west Bengal region earlier This, combined with potential disruptions to the IPL schedule, has been to the decision to move the final to a more weather -resilient venue.

    What does this mean for the playoffs?

    In addition to the rescheduling of the final, the Bcci has also decided to shift the venues for the IPL 2025 Playoffs. Initially, kolkata was set to host both qualifier 1 and the final, while hyderabad was earmarked for Qualifier 2 and the Eliminator. However, due to similar weather concerns, even hyderabad has been relieved of its playoff duties.

    Reports sugges that ahmedabad’s narendra modi stadium is the most likely candidate to host the rescheduled IPL 2025 Qualifier 2 and Final. With only a 30% chance of rain in ahmedabad on June 3, it stands as a much safer alternative compared to kolkata. The shift to ahmedabad offers a promising venue with a large capacity and a track record of hosting high-profile matches.
